Zur Kenntnis der Ammonium-fluoromanganate(III)

Abstract:Investigation of the system MnF3–NH4F–HF–H2O revealed considerable hydrolysis even in highly acidic media. NH4MnF4 with a tetragonal unit cell,a=7.752 (6),c=6.153 (12) Å andZ=4, was isolated together with the already known (NH4)2MnF5 and (NH4)3MnF6. No splittings of the valence modes were observed with hexa- and penta-fluoromanganates, although the deformation of the octahedra was evident. Splitting was characteristic of the tetrafluoro compound. The spectrum of ammonium ion indicated increasing hydrogenbonding in the sequence hexa-, penta-, tetra-fluoromanganate.
